We are currently seeking a skilled and enthusiastic Legal Secretary to join our client’s growing legal team. This is an exciting opportunity for a professional who is eager to contribute to their legal department and support its operations effectively.
Key Responsibilities
Provide administrative support to the legal team, including managing correspondence and communications.
Prepare and format legal documents, contracts, and reports accurately and efficiently.
Maintain and organize legal files, documentation, and records to ensure easy access and retrieval.
Assist in conducting research and preparing summaries of legal information.
Coordinate meetings, prepare agendas, and take minutes as required.
Ensure compliance with legal procedures and documentation requirements.
Requirements
Previous experience as a Legal Secretary or in a similar administrative role preferred.
High level of pro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
Strong organizational skills with keen attention to detail.
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
Ability to multitask and prioritize tasks effectively.
Proactive attitude and ability to work well within a team as well as independently.
Knowledge of Legal Terminology and Procedures is advantageous.
Fluency in English (both spoken and written) is essential.
